With its CAS number 63-91-2, this essential amino acid is more than just a nutrient; it's a vital precursor for numerous biological pathways and a key ingredient in many therapeutic products.

L-Phenylalanine is well-known as a precursor for critical neurotransmitters such as dopamine and norepinephrine, which are fundamental for cognitive function and mood regulation. In the pharmaceutical sector, its role extends to the production of aspartame, a widely used artificial sweetener. Furthermore, its involvement in protein biosynthesis makes it indispensable for cell growth and repair, underpinning its use in various recovery and therapeutic formulations.
